Ingredients:
Bloody Mountaineer –
- 1 Bottle of Plain Bloody Mary Mix
- 24 oz. Everest Original Freeze
- ½ t Salt
- ½ t Black Pepper
- 1 t Olive Juice
- 1T Horseradish Sauce
- 10 Shakes Hot Sauce
- ½ t Worcestershire Sauce
- 1 Fresh Lemon
- Spicy Rim –
- 2T Garlic Powder
- 1t Salt
- 1T Paprika
- 1 t Black Pepper
- ¼ t Chili Powder
- Garnish –
- Thick Cut Bacon
- Celery
- Olive
- Rosemary
Directions –
In a large pitcher add:
- 1 Bottle of Plain Bloody Mary Mix
- ½ t Salt
- ½ t Black Pepper
- 1 t Olive Juice
- 1T Horseradish Sauce
- 10 Shakes Hot Sauce
- ½ t Worcestershire Sauce
- ½ the Juice of a Fresh Lemon
Stir all ingredients together. Cover and let sit overnight in the refrigerator.
In the meantime, prepare the spicy rim by mixing:
- 2T Garlic Powder
- 1t Salt
- 1T Paprika
- 1 t Black Pepper
- ¼ t Chili Powder
Store in an air-tight container until ready to use.
Cook the thick cut bacon. Lay on a flat surface and pat dry so that it will stand straight up when cool. Store in the refrigerator until ready to use.
The next day moisten the rim of a tall glass with a lemon wedge. Gently roll the edge of the tall glass in the spicy mixture until rim is completely coated. Carefully fill the glass with ice. Add 5 oz. of the Bloody Mountaineer Mix into the glass being careful not to disrupt the spicy rim. Top with 2 oz. of Everest Original Freeze and stir. Garnish with celery, bacon, an olive, and a sprig of rosemary.
